GOVERNMENT OF ANDHRA PRADESH
ABSTRACT
POLICE – Promotion of Addl. Commandant, APSP Battalions as
Commandant, APSP Bns., - Orders – Issued.

ORDER:-
In the G.O. 3rd read above, Government approved the panel of the
following (14) Addl. Commandants, APSP Bns., fit for adhoc promotion as
Commandants, APSP Bns., for the panel year 2011-2012, subject to
directions, outcome of the O.As/W.Ps/W.As/R.Ps/C.As., etc. pending, if any,
before the Tribunal/Courts etc.,

2. In terms of Rule-10 (a) of A.P. State & Subordinate Service Rules,
1996, Government hereby promote Sri K.Parameswara Rao, Addl.
Commandant, APSP Battalions, included in the panel as Commandant, APSP
Bns., with immediate effect, subject to condition that the commencement of
probation in the promoted post will be only after completion of minimum
service in the feeder category, as mentioned in the G.O. 1st read above.
3. The promotion ordered in para (2) above is purely temporary and is
liable to be reverted to the lower post at any time without assigning any
reason therefore and is subject to outcome of O.As/W.Ps/W.As/R.Ps/C.As.,
pending, if any, before the Tribunal and Courts.
4. The Officer promoted in para-3 above shall join in the promotion post
within a period of 15 days from the date of receipt of the orders of
promotion. If, he fails to join the new post within the said time limit or evade
to join the post by proceeding on leave, he shall forfeit his right of
appointment both for the present and in future for his promotion post.2
5. The Director General of Police, A.P., Hyderabad, is requested to issue
posting orders in respect of Sri K.Parameswara Rao, at his level as he is
retiring from service on 29.2.2012 on superannuation and send
ratification proposals to the Government. He is also requested to send
promotional posting proposals in respect of others after placing the matter
before the Police Establishment Board.
